This week on the podcast, we have Chloe Dulce Louvouezo, author of the book Life, I Swear: Intimate Stories from Black Women on Identity, Healing, and Self-Trust. Chloe is also the founder of Open Door Concept, an event space for film, photos, and events space for rent to bring together elements that bring them joy: creativity, community, and conversation.   As women, we are constantly assessing what it is we’re doing and what we need to do. This conversation is all about how to discover what you want to do, the stories we tell ourselves, and the power of recognizing our own stories. Let this be an invitation to begin a practice of coming home to yourself through pen and paper.
